The Election Commission of Pakistan (ECP) seeks a report from the returning officer within three days.


Islamabad: The Election Commission of Pakistan (ECP) on Wednesday postponed the notification of the victory of National Assembly candidate Awn Chaudhary from Istehkam-e-Pakistan Party (IPP).
The ECP sought a report from the returning officer within three days, and a decision was reserved on Salman Akram Raja's application.
Independent candidate Salman Akram Raja's application was decided upon by the Election Commission of Pakistan yesterday.
In a separate development, re-polling at some polling stations in NA-88 Khushab, PS-18 Ghotki-I, and PK-90 Kohat-I will be held on Thursday (tomorrow).
Election Commission of Pakistan had ordered re-polling due to pilferage, snatching, and burning of polling material in these constituencies.
Provincial Election Commissioner Punjab Ejaz Anwar Chauhan presided over a meeting in Lahore today and reviewed the preparations for re-polling to be held at 26 polling stations of NA-88 Khushab.
